What's Happening?
The Cruise Lines International Association (CLIA) is focusing on river and expedition cruising during its October Cruise Month campaign. This initiative includes new educational opportunities for travel agent members, featuring interactive Spotlight Sessions that will explore the latest developments in these dynamic areas of cruising. These sessions will be recorded in front of a live audience and made available online to CLIA members. The campaign is structured around four weekly themes: Ocean Cruising, River Cruising, Expedition Cruising, and Luxury Cruising. The sessions aim to enhance travel agents' product knowledge and provide insights from industry leaders. A select group of CLIA members will participate in the live audience in Sydney, contributing to the discussions and recordings.
Why It's Important?
The focus on river and expedition cruising reflects significant investment and innovation in these sectors, which have become increasingly popular. By equipping travel agents with deeper insights and practical knowledge, CLIA aims to capitalize on this growing interest and drive consumer engagement. This initiative is crucial for the travel industry as it seeks to recover from the impacts of the pandemic, offering agents tools to better market and sell these unique travel experiences. The campaign also supports the broader travel ecosystem by directing consumers to local CLIA travel consultants, potentially boosting business for these professionals.
What's Next?
CLIA's Cruise Month will continue with its planned weekly themes, providing ongoing resources and marketing tools for its members. The Spotlight Sessions will be added to CLIA's professional development library, serving as a long-term resource for travel agents. As the campaign progresses, it is expected to generate increased interest and bookings in river and expedition cruising, benefiting both the cruise lines and travel agents involved.
